Disillusionment and Drought: A Dual Crisis

This chapter explores the widespread disillusionment among Venezuelans with political negotiations under Maduro, highlighting a prevailing sense of cynicism and apathy. Additionally, it sheds light on the severe drought in southern Madagascar, illustrating the desperate living conditions amid extreme poverty and environmental challenges.
